Karen Vaughan is a scholar working on Civil and Structural Engineering, Environmental Chemistry and Soil Science. According to data from OpenAlex, Karen Vaughan has authored 25 papers receiving a total of 243 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Civil and Structural Engineering, 7 papers in Environmental Chemistry and 6 papers in Soil Science. Recurrent topics in Karen Vaughan’s work include Soil and Unsaturated Flow (7 papers), Mine drainage and remediation techniques (6 papers) and Heavy metals in environment (4 papers). Karen Vaughan is often cited by papers focused on Soil and Unsaturated Flow (7 papers), Mine drainage and remediation techniques (6 papers) and Heavy metals in environment (4 papers). Karen Vaughan collaborates with scholars based in United States, South Africa and China. Karen Vaughan's co-authors include Martin C. Rabenhorst, P. A. McDaniel, Brian A. Needelman, R. E. Vaughan, Jacob Berkowitz, Asmeret Asefaw Berhe, Leslie L. Baker, Yamina Pressler, Eric C. Brevik and Daniel G. Strawn and has published in prestigious journals such as Geochimica et Cosmochimica Acta, The Science of The Total Environment and Soil Science Society of America Journal.
